John Turner to Evin Lewis, OUT! CAUGHT BEHIND! A touch of fortune but the short-ball ploy to Lewis has paid off for Turner and England! Turner goes wide of the crease on the around-the-wicket angle and goes into the wicket. Gets the line wrong as it is down leg. Lewis shapes up for the pull but goes through the shot a bit early and the ball does not bounce as much as he was anticipating. The ball brushes his gloves and goes behind. The keeper, Phil Salt moves to his right and snaffles it with ease. Both openers back in the hut for West Indies. They are now 12/2 after 3.1 overs.

John Turner to Brandon King, OUT! CAUGHT! A maiden international wicket for Turner and he is thrilled to bits! He has Jordan Cox to thank. It was a tough catch but Cox made it look easy. Turner hurls it on the fuller side, around off, King is lured into the drive and he plays at the delivery away from his body. Gets a thickish outside edge and it goes low to the left of backward point. Cox reacts quickly to his left and pouches it. West Indies lose one early and are 7/1!

PITCH REPORT - Nikhil Uttamchandani is near the deck. He says that there was some rain around overnight but the skies look clear right now. Proceeds to tell about the boundary dimensions - the square boundaries are equidistant - 63 metres each with the straight boundary being 73 metres. Carlos Brathwaite joins him and says there is a little bit of moisture and it will be challenging for West Indies up front. Mentions that it will be important for the pacers to hit the 6-8 metre lengths. Ends by saying that it will be crucial for the fast bowlers to be disciplined and for the spinners to control their pace.
We have had some rain around overnight. So far it's clear. 63m square boundaries and 73m down the ground. There's a little bit more moisture, could hamper the team batting first. Fast bowlers should hit the 6-8m length. Very important for the fast bowlers to be disciplined and for the spinners to control their pace.
